Chrysler Concorde LXI 1999 3.2L engine.
Where Are the spark plugs located ?
Are there located on the top of the engine ?
How do I change them ?
Do I need platinum plug such as Bosch +4 ?

I haven't personal experience with that engine, but the plugs appear to be on the top of the engine in the 6 cavities on either side of the intake manifold. The trick appears to be that the spark plug wire connecting caps each have a spark coil built into it (called a coil on plug connector) so the caps are a lot larger and square. I don't know if they pull off the plug in the traditional manner but you could look for any other disconnector and if seeing none try to pull off gently. I don't know about the Bosch + 4 but you can see what type came with the car, and then see if there is a Bosch for your purpose. I have no argument with the +4's. You might want to buy a Haynes manual for the car, which I have found to be good for the amateur mechanic.
